Why Clean Trucks? Public concerns about air pollution and health risks have slowed port development Trucks are a major source of air pollution Health risks need to be reduced so the Port can continue to support trade and the economy The Ports Clean Air Action Plan will reduce pollution from Port sources 45% by 2012 5
Clean Truck Program Effective October 1, 2008, trucks will be allowed access to the Port, only if: They operate for a trucking firm (Licensed Motor Carrier) with a Port-approved concession and They are registered in Port s Drayage Truck Registry 6
Clean Trucks Schedule October 1, 2008: Model Year 1988 and older trucks banned unless equipped with newer engine January 1, 2010: Prohibit entry to trucks with Model Year 89-93 engines, and MY 94-03 trucks not retrofitted January 1, 2012: Prohibit entry to any truck that does not meet 2007 EPA engine emission standards 7
Clean Trucks Fee Loaded containers moved by trucks with 1989-2006 engines will be assessed a $35 per TEU fee The temporary fee will help provide financial assistance to truckers for the one-time transition to new, clean trucks The fee will be charged to cargo owners 8
More on fees Unlike PierPass, the Clean Trucks Fee will be charged on domestic cargo (for example, Mainland trade destined for Hawaii, Guam and Alaska) Clean Trucks Fee also applies to cargo trucked to rail yards outside the Port
Fee Exemptions Diesel or Alternative Fuel Truck (Engine year 2006 or older) FEE APPLIES $35 per loaded TEU Diesel Truck (Engine Year 2007 or newer) purchased with Clean Trucks Program funds FEE APPLIES $35 per loaded TEU Scrappage of old truck required Diesel Truck (Model Year 2007 with a 2006 Engine) purchased without Clean Trucks Program funds FEE APPLIES $35 per loaded TEU
Fee Exemptions (cont d) Diesel Truck (engine year 2007 or newer) purchased without Clean Trucks Program funds 100% EXEMPT if truck is purchased before 10/1/2008 50% EXEMPT ($17.50 per loaded TEU) if purchased on or after 10/1/2008 and proof of scrappage of old truck is provided FEE APPLIES ($35 per loaded TEU) if truck is purchased on or after 10/1/2008 and proof of scrappage of old truck is not provided
Fee Exemptions (cont d) Alternative Fuel truck (i.e. LNG) (Engine Year 2007 or newer) purchased with Clean Trucks Program funds Alternative Fuel truck (i.e. LNG) (Engine Year 2007 or newer) purchased without Clean Trucks Program funds FEE APPLIES $35 per loaded TEU Scrappage of old truck required 100% EXEMPT if truck is purchased before 10/1/2008 no scrappage proof required 100% EXEMPT if truck is purchased on or after 10/1/2008 and proof of scrappage is provided FEE APPLIES ($35 per loaded TEU ) if truck is purchased on or after 10/1/2008 and proof of scrappage of old truck is not provided

Concession Sign Up Concessions required after October 1, 2008, for all Drayage Truck operations 178+ trucking firms signed up with 5,550 trucks 4,500 trucks at Port of Los Angeles also expected to sign up with Port of Long Beach Cargo owners: Urge all trucking firms to sign up to assure your cargo can move on October 1 14
Drayage Truck Registry (DTR) DTR launched September 2, 2008 Trucks already in emodal s Trucker Check can be added to DTR by trucking companies Trucking firms responsible for entering and maintaining truck data Only trucks in DTR will be allowed access 15

Transition to Clean Trucks Port of Long Beach Program provides generous subsidies to ensure your cargo moves swiftly and smoothly through our Port. Ports, State offering financial assistance to help truckers obtain clean trucks: Lease to own Subsidized loans 17
Applications for Financial Assistance Clean Truck Center open since July 1 Assisted 3,000+ truckers Received 350 applications for new trucks Applications are being processed 500 Clean Trucks already on order Sales and Leasing Office opens next week in Long Beach 18

PortCheck PortCheck is the new organization being created to collect the Clean Trucks Fee from cargo owners PortCheck will operate like PierPass collect fees from cargo owners via an on-line, internet system. All cargo must be claimed by cargo owner before it can be moved 20
More on PortCheck Fee will be based on EPA compliance status of the engine, whether port funds paid for the truck and other factors A $100 day pass will be provided non-frequent truckers, paid by the trucking company or broker 21
Cargo owner action items If you are not already registered with Pier Pass, go on line and register now so you can claim your cargo come October 1. Book cargo only with trucking companies with a Port-approved concession Make sure trucks used to move your cargo are registered in DTR 22
